Course Description
Falls are the leading cause of fatalities in the construction industry, accounting for nearly one-third of all construction-related deaths each year, according to OSHA statistics. Most of these tragic incidents are entirely preventable with proper safety measures in place. Fall protection isn't just a regulatory requirement—it's a life-saving necessity.

Construction sites often involve working at heights such as roofs, scaffolds, ladders, or open edges. Without effective fall protection systems, workers are at constant risk of serious injury or death.

Fall protection is not optional. It's a fundamental component of construction site safety. By prioritizing fall protection, construction companies demonstrate their commitment to worker health, legal compliance, and operational excellence. Every measure taken to prevent a fall is a step toward a safer, more successful job site.
Course overview
This comprehensive online course is designed to equip construction workers, supervisors, and safety personnel with the knowledge and skills necessary to identify, prevent, and manage fall hazards on construction sites.

It aligns with OSHA standards, particularly 29 CFR 1926 Subpart M, ensuring compliance and promoting a safer work environment

Course Objectives

The main purpose of this session is to familiarize you with fall protection on a construction site. The objectives of this session include being able to:

Recognize Fall Hazards and Protection Needs

Recognize fall hazards and identify when fall protection is needed

Use Basic Fall Protection Systems

Use basic fall protection systems

Prevent Falling Objects

Prevent objects from falling

Inspect Fall Arrest Equipment

Inspect personal fall arrest systems

Perform Fall Rescues

Rescue yourself and others from falls
